frick it. I’ll jump.

For the first shooting (the fatality). The officer shot the guy who was POINTING A LOADED GUN at him and his partner. The gun was recovered at the scene next to the body of the deceased. Not really sure why anyone has an issue with that one.

For the more contentious shooting, there was a vehicle and then foot chase. The guy he was chasing ran through someone’s house and out the back door. The officer followed. The guy running away was grabbing at his waist band. Probably because his pants were falling down. FWIW, more than a few sagging pants wearers have been shot over grabbing at their waistband in those situations. As the officer was on the back porch he heard a loud noise, saw the guy grabbing and thought he was being shot at. So he shot back. It has always been my contention that he probably was startled by the back door slamming and thought it was a gunshot and his brain filled in the rest. Not good but not criminal either. Luckily he missed the guy.

The kicker is that HE PASSED THE POLYGRAPH. He legit believes he was shot at on that day. But the Chief fired him for “untruthfulness” any way. The Chief is a dumb arse. If you are convinced he is lieing to you then fire him. But don’t give him a poly to prove your point and when it doesn’t go your way, fire him anyway. Once he passed the poly, if the Chief thinks the guy is a problem then bury him on desk duty in the motor pool for eternity. This has been clown shoes from the get go.

I think this guy probably shouldn’t be out patrolling but I also don’t think he is some wild eyed killer. Or a liar. I think he got nervous, since he was almost killed by a guy less than a year earlier, and he cranked a round off when he shouldn’t have done so.
